4,295,031,876 is a composite number, even.
4,295,031,876 (four billion two hundred ninety-five million thirty-one thousand eight hundred seventy-six) is an even 10-digit number. It is a composite number with 36 divisors, and factors as 2² × 3² × 83 × 1,437,427. Its proper divisors sum to 6,692,667,756,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000FC44.
